Shop
Showing 3889–3904 of 4089 results
Sort by:
Venpres A 40mg/10mg Tablet
Telmisartan, Atorvastatin
Venpres AMC Tablet
Telmisartan, Amlodipine, Chlorthalidone
Showing 3889–3904 of 4089 results

